Transaction 42d5cb24cfe12a61b70ac61ee1605e2032ad39bf9c6dadd522349131675231a8
1 Input
2 Outputs
- 42d5cb24cfe12a61b70ac61ee1605e2032ad39bf9c6dadd522349131675231a8:0
- 42d5cb24cfe12a61b70ac61ee1605e2032ad39bf9c6dadd522349131675231a8:1
value 11998970
address 15EAW3dvwBr5s8w77oLtH5B3kMYSH7drxw
value 53176
address 1HjALooAZowtExgP146ba8NTiBo1c1zzv1